In the world of gastronomy, serving food is not just about satisfying hunger. It's about creating lasting memories and forging connections that resonate long after the meal is over.

Every dish tells a story, and with each meal we share, we embed a significant mark on our relationships. This is the philosophy that drives the culinary journey of many chefs today.

Personalization through ingredients can infuse a meal with a sense of depth and connection. Each person's palate is influenced by memories, cultures, and nostalgia. Understanding this is key to crafting extraordinary dishes that resonate with clients on a deeply personal level.

For instance, a client with a keen interest in Hawaiian cuisine yearned for a lighter, fresher menu for a summer gathering. The poke bowl phenomenon took off, and by melding traditional poke elements with vibrant local ingredients, a dish was crafted that celebrated both the trend and the client's individual tastes.

Cultural threads can also resonate with clients when designing a menu. Growing up in a multicultural neighbourhood shaped an understanding of how culture influences culinary preferences. This insight was instrumental in creating a grill-inspired menu featuring smoky tempeh and grilled vegetable skewers, capturing that nostalgic essence without compromising the client's lifestyle choice.

Engaging deeply with clients to understand their stories, preferences, and cultural influences allows for the creation of dishes that are not just delicious, but also meaningful. Knowing a client's favorite dish or flavor can reveal much more than a preference for a certain cuisine.

Incorporating plant-based diets in menu creation is essential for customization. This is not just about catering to dietary restrictions, but also about offering a diverse range of options that reflect the client's values and lifestyle.

When curating a menu for clients, it's important to delve into their preferences and ask thoughtful questions. By doing so, we can create dishes that are not only delicious, but also evoke memories, emotions, and connections that make every meal a unique and unforgettable experience.
